Best Time to Visit Great Doddington
The best time to visit is during the spring or summer months (April-September) for pleasant weather and longer daylight hours. Autumn offers beautiful colours in the countryside, but be prepared for cooler temperatures. Winter can be cold and wet, but offers a different kind of charm.
